
Kia (000270.KS) said Thursday it was named "Best Manufacturer" at the 2026 Top Gear EV Awards, organized by British automotive publication Top Gear.
Kia was recognized for building a diverse electric vehicle lineup ranging from affordable models such as the EV2 to high-performance sport utility vehicles (SUVs) like the EV9 GT. The Best Manufacturer category was newly established this year to recognize companies leading the transition to electrification.
"Across the Kia EV range — from the EV3 and the large SUV EV9, to the sleek EV6 and the boxy PV5 — there is a common sense of well-polished completeness," said Ollie Kew, deputy editor of Top Gear. "They are building a diverse EV lineup based on reliable range, accessible performance and satisfying ride quality."
Kia won the Best Crossover EV category at the Top Gear EV Awards last year. "In recent years, Kia has been introducing a variety of electric vehicles in Europe," a Kia official said. "Through this, we have been able to meet the needs of European customers."
